Leadership Review Briefing — Training Budget. Heads of department: next year's training pot at Brindlemoor Group rises modestly, with most of the uplift earmarked for the Fieldcraft certification push. Department allocations shift toward frontline roles; leadership courses move to in-house delivery. Please flag must-have external programmes before the review. Context for the numbers sits in the confidential note below.

board note of kageg-bahof: The renewal with Holwynax Holdings closes at $2 million a year, 5 percent below the last contract. Project Ulaath slips by two quarters because of the supplier delay.

# Finance Review — Orvale Division Hiring Freeze

Summary for the incoming director: the Orvale division hiring freeze, now in its third quarter, has held payroll flat while revenue grew 4%. Twelve requisitions remain paused; attrition backfills require VP approval. Contractor spend rose 6% and needs monitoring. Morale impact is noted in recent surveys but remains manageable. The freeze is tied to a broader decision, outlined confidentially below.

board note of fahif-yahog: Gross margin on Wenath came in at 10 percent against a plan of 5 percent. Only 3 of the 100 pilot accounts renewed Wenath, so a churn review is set for July 15.

## Further Reading

Offline mode in FieldNote Surveyor relies on a local write-ahead queue that reconciles with the Harborline sync service once connectivity returns. Maintainers changing the conflict-resolution rules should read the sync design notes carefully, as ordering guarantees are subtle. The complete architecture rationale and known edge cases are written up on the internal page below.

operations page: https://vault.qorvelcorp.example/settings